Your suspicions are hardly naive -- the compiler makes a first pass over the top level forms in sequence, collecting information as it goes, then writes the output in pass 2 using said information. This means that a defun calling one further down in the file will not have available its auto-proclamation info, etc., leaving any conflicts to be resolved at load time.
This will obviously get simple (i.e. self) recursion wrong, so the compiler iterates over the pass1 processing of the single top level form in question in this case. In general, in the case where all functions are in the same file, it would be possible to effectively do the recompile before writing the output in pass2. This will only mitigate, and not eliminate, the necessity of recompiling at load time, which you feel is deprecated, I'm sure with good reason. I had thought that since this would not solve the entire problem, best to do the conflict resolution in one place for all cases, i.e. at load time. I'm most interested in your example for another reason, as it exposes a weakness in the current algorithm in the case of mutual recursion. Chicken-and-egg ordering/bootstrapping problems aside, the signature arrived at here was ((fixnum fixnum fixnum) *), not ((fixnum fixnum fixnum) fixnum), (as is the case for a simple self-recursion version of tak, as I've just confirmed). We need to sketch out a good algorithm here. (Initially, I had naively thought that this could be resolved easily using reverse type propagation, at least in this case, using the call to tak0 using as (known fixnum) argument the result from tak1, but this clearly won't work at all, as the function result type could vary with input, and even return multiple values). Somehow, we have to do the simple-recursion iteration across multiple functions, and again the comprehensive time to do this is at load time. The way the former (i.e. self-recursion) works is to assume the return type is nil, compile the function, get an expanded return type, and recompile until we get the same result twice.
